Journal ArticleDOI
Neutron production in bombardments of thin and thick W, Hg, Pb targets by 0.4, 0.8, 1.2, 1.8 and 2.5 GeV protons
A. Letourneau,J. Galin,F. Goldenbaum,B. Lott,A. Péghaire,M. Enke,D. Hilscher,U. Jahnke,K. Nünighoff,Detlef Filges,R.-D. Neef,N. Paul,H. Schaal,G. Sterzenbach,A. Tietze +14 more
TL;DR: In this article, experimental data relevant to the design of the target of neutron spallation sources are presented and discussed, including the reaction cross-sections for W, Hg and Pb investigated with 0.4, 0.8, 1.2 and 2.5 GeV proton beams as well as the neutron production, neutron multiplicity distribution, as determined event per event using a high efficiency detector.
Journal ArticleDOI
Mass measurement of light neutron-rich fragmentation products
A. Gillibert,L. Bianchi,A. Cunsolo,B. Fernandez,A. Foti,J. Gastebois,Ch. Gregoire,W. Mittig,A. Péghaire,Y. Schutz,Christoph A. Stephan +10 more
TL;DR: In this paper, direct mass measurements of nitrogen, oxygen and fluorine neutron-rich isotopes were performed using the GANIL facility and the new magnetic spectrometer SPEG.
